jQuery(function(){
	jQuery("div.csw").prepend("<p class='loading'></p>");
});
var j = 0;

function CarrouselPlay(mediaSrc,type){
	jQuery('#carrouselplay').html('');
	switch(type){
		case 'img':
			jQuery('#carrouselplay').html('<img src="'+mediaSrc+'" alt=""/>');
		break;
		case 'swf':
			displaySwf(mediaSrc);
		break;
		
	}
}

function displaySwf(mediaSrc){1
	
	var s = new SWFObject(mediaSrc, "swfPlayer", "960", "290", "9");
	s.addParam("allowfullscreen","true");
	s.addParam("wmode","transparent");
	s.addVariable('usefullscreen', 'false');
	s.addVariable('autostart', "true");
	s.addVariable('displayheight', "290");
	s.addVariable('height', "290");
	s.addVariable('displaywidth', "960");
	s.addVariable('width', "960");
	s.write("carrouselplay");
}


jQuery.fn.carrousel = function(settings) {
	settings = jQuery.extend({
	easeFunc: "expoinout",
	easeTime: 1200,
	toolTip: false
  }, settings);
	return this.each(function(){
		var container = jQuery(this);
		var cantidad = jQuery.cantidad;
		container.find("p.loading").remove();
		container.removeClass("csw").addClass("stripViewer");
		var panelWidth = container.find("div.panel").width();
		var panelCount = container.find("div.panel").size();
		var stripViewerWidth = panelWidth*panelCount;
		container.find("div.panelContainer").css("width" , stripViewerWidth);
		var navWidth = panelCount*2;
		var cPanel = 1;


		container.each(function(i) {

			jQuery(this).before("<div class='stripNavL' id='stripNavL" + j + "'><a href='#'></a><\/div>");
			jQuery(this).after("<div class='stripNavR' id='stripNavR" + j + "'><a href='#'></a><\/div>");
			
			// Left nav
			jQuery("div#stripNavL" + j + " a").click(function(){
				//alert("cPanel:"+cPanel+"\n panelCount:"+panelCount+"\n cantidad:"+cantidad);
				if (cPanel == 1 && panelCount > cantidad) {
					var cnt = - (panelWidth*((panelCount-(cantidad-1)) - 1));
					cPanel = panelCount;
				} else if (cPanel == 1 && panelCount <= cantidad){
					return false;
				} else if (cPanel == panelCount){
					cPanel -= cantidad;
					var cnt = - (panelWidth*(cPanel - 1));
				} else {
					cPanel -= 1;
					var cnt = - (panelWidth*(cPanel - 1));
				};
				jQuery(this).parent().parent().find("div.panelContainer").animate({ left: cnt}, settings.easeTime, settings.easeFunc);
				return false;
				
			});
			
			// Right nav
			jQuery("div#stripNavR" + j + " a").click(function(){
				//alert("cPanel = " + cPanel + "\n panelCount = " + panelCount + "\n" + "cantidad = " + cantidad);
				if (cPanel >= panelCount-(cantidad-1)) {
					var cnt = 0;
					cPanel = 1;
				} else {
					var cnt = - (panelWidth*cPanel);
					cPanel += 1;
				};
				jQuery(this).parent().parent().find("div.panelContainer").animate({ left: cnt}, settings.easeTime, settings.easeFunc);
				return false;
			});

			jQuery("div#stripNav" + j).css("width" , navWidth);
			
		});
		
		j++;
  });
};
